Parents and teachers should prioritize basic addition skills for 4-year-olds because they serve as the foundational building blocks for a child’s mathematical understanding. At this age, children are naturally curious and eager to learn, making it an ideal time to introduce simple addition concepts, such as combining quantities and understanding number relationships.

Developing early addition skills lays the groundwork for future math competency, facilitating smoother transitions into more complex arithmetic as children progress in their education. Furthermore, engaging in basic addition nurtures critical thinking and problem-solving abilities, which are essential in all areas of learning.

Additionally, practicing easy addition enhances a child's cognitive development by promoting logical reasoning and spatial awareness. It also fosters a positive attitude towards math, reducing anxiety later in their academic journey. Collaborative activities, such as games or manipulatives, can make learning enjoyable, strengthening the bond between parents, teachers, and children.

Ultimately, instilling basic addition skills at a young age equips children with the confidence they need to tackle future math challenges, contributing to their overall academic success and lifelong learning.
